President Joe Biden introduced a proposal Thursday that would allow high schools and colleges to ban some transgender individuals from participating in sports, according to the Washington Post.

"The proposed rule ... recognizes that in some instances, particularly in competitive high school and college athletic environments, some schools may adopt policies that limit transgender students' participation," the Education Department said in a fact sheet. It said the proposal would give schools"the flexibility to develop their own participation policies."
